ArtsWestchester’s Third Annual Arts Exchange exhibition will open on February 8 with an inspiring array of artistic talent.
The exhibition in ArtsWestchester’s downtown White Plains gallery celebrates the work of more than 40 emerging and established artists from across the region.
“We’re excited to see the creative breadth and depth of the painters, sculptors, and photographers in this exhibit. This robust survey of artists, which include a selection of our Arts Alive grantees, has something for everyone to enjoy,” said Kathleen Reckling, CEO of ArtsWestchester.
ArtsWestchester is celebrating its 60th anniversary in 2025, and the Arts Exchange exhibition represents ArtsWestchester’s continuing efforts to provide artists with public platforms. This year’s exhibition will also feature the winner of the Larry Salley Photography Award as well as the 2024 Arts Alive Visual Art Grantees.
Exhibition Highlights Include:
- Opening Reception on Saturday, February 8 from 1:00 p.m. to 3:00 p.m., featuring remarks from prominent arts advocates, live music, and an opportunity to meet the artists. Selections from The Last Ibex, a musical by Joel Weber Knopf, will be performed during the reception.
- Community Programming: Throughout the exhibition’s run, ArtsWestchester will host a series of interactive workshops, artist talks, and guided tours designed to engage audiences of all ages.
Participating artists include Kwame Anyane-Yeboa, Nana Yaa Anyane-Yeboa, Elizabeth de Bethune, Theresa Beyer, Gabriela Bornstein, Allison Belolan, Cornell Carelock, Sarah Coble and Leslye Smith, Dan Cohen, Meg le Comte, Mary Ellis, Donna Faranda, Margaret Fox, Lisa Freeman, Lori Ganz, Tim Grajek, Ruth Geneslaw, Ashley Gerst, Bryan Greene, Linda Greenhouse, Brian Hart, Susan Hoeltzel, Katarina Hoeger, Alan Jacobson, Lance Johnson, Kahori Kamiya, Arnold Kastenbaum, Mindy Kombert, Youngheui Lee Lim, Wendy Leopold, Denis Licul, Esther Lo, Constance Manna, Susan Manspeizer, Marie Mcnicholas, Sari Nordman, Jill Parry, Sherri Paul, Amy Schneider, Anna Sirota, Fleur Spolidor, Joseph Squillante, Susan Stillman, Stuart Vance, and Mitchell Visoky.
The Arts Exchange exhibition is open Wednesday through Sunday from noon to 5 p.m. and admission is $5. ArtsWestchester’s Gallery is located at 31 Mamaroneck Avenue in White Plains. For more information about the exhibition and related events, visit ArtsWestchester’s website.
About ArtsWestchester:
For 60 years, ArtsWestchester has been dedicated to supporting and promoting the arts in Westchester County. Through grants, programs, and events, the organization works to ensure that the arts remain an integral part of the community’s cultural and economic vitality.
